About this coffee

A Gesha microlot from Finca Los Naranjos, high in the mountains of the Acevedo district of Huila, where Luis Erney Claros and his family tend the cherries by hand with an emphasis on quality. Alongside traditional Castillo the farm works with rarer, experimental varieties like this Gesha; the lot placed 1st in Colombia's Top Roast competition in 2023 and 2nd in 2024. Hand-picked and strictly sorted for ripeness, then fermented 60–80 hours with a macerate of aromatic herbs before being fully washed and dried for about two weeks. Fresh, light and pronounced sweetness — rooibos, lemongrass, sweet lime and a vivid limoncello note. Source: eshop.qb.coffee
